What We Don't Take

Although the Habitat ReStore appreciates all of the offers of donations it receives, there are some items that it cannot accept.

  • Housewares and dishes
  • Used window coverings
  • Large or small appliances
  • Dirty, broken or worn out furniture
  • Electronics
  • Toys
  • Clothing
  • Exercise and sports equipment
  • Books
  • Materials with nails or screws not removed
  • Damaged, moldy, rotten or dirty materials
  • Carpet
  • Paint from the general public
  • Unframed mirrors
In Ottawa at this time there are NO charities that accept large applicance, hazardous waste, or paint from the public. However, here is a list of local charities who you may wish to contact for other donations such as dishes and toys:
